"Grounded in scripture, rooted in prayer, discovering what God is up to" - Bishop Beckwith's address at the 141st Annual Convention

Kicker: 
141st Annual Diocesan Convention
By: 
The Rt. Rev. Mark M. Beckwith, Bishop of Newark
Bishop Mark Beckwith

On July 3 of this past year, I was scheduled to travel to Liberia as the Presiding Bishop’s representative at the consecration of my friend and colleague, Jonathan Hart, as Archbishop of West Africa.

On July 2, I received an email from Kit Cone, a member of Grace, Madison, who had lived in Liberia and has a long list of partnerships and relationships in West Africa. Kit had bundled together a series of emails from medical people in Liberia, England and the US indicating that the Ebola virus had not just spread to Monrovia, where the consecration was to take place; it was out of control.

New book to help churches challenge gun violence epidemic

Kicker: 
Announcement
Reclaiming the Gospel of Peace, Challenging the Epidemic of Gun Violence

Church leaders including Archbishop of Canterbury Justin Welby, Presiding Bishop Katharine Jefferts Schori and our own Bishop Mark Beckwith have contributed to a book that "aims to help dioceses, congregations, and individuals reclaim the Gospel message of peace for our society."
